Today's prayer meditation is on Proverbs 14

Father God, I encourage and build up my family. I am not so foolish as to tear it down by my own actions. I love truth and follow the right path because of my wonderment and worship of you.

My words have become a shield of protection around me. 

I do not lie. I hunger for understanding and revelation-knowledge flows to me. My words are like weapons of knowledge. 

When I need wise counsel, I stay away from fools. The wisdom of the wise keeps my life on the right track. I do not deceive myself, and I am not afraid to face reality.

Your favor rests upon me, Father. 

I don't expect anyone else to fully understand the bitterness and the joys I have experienced in my life. You alone know and understand, Father. 

My family flourishes in the paths of righteousness. I do not have to try to rationalize poor choices, or justify a path of error. I follow the path you have set before me. 

It is a path filled with joy and the true laughter that can heal a heavy heart. I do not turn away from the truth. I receive a sweet reward for my goodness. 

I am sensible, and confirm the facts before I believe in what I'm told. I am careful in all things, and turn quickly from evil. I am neither impetuous nor overconfident. I show self-control, rather than being impulsive or having a short fuse. I am not naïve, but love wisdom. I am crowned with revelation-knowledge. 

Even the evil ones pay tribute to me. I am kind to the poor, and I am blessed and prosper. Kindness and truth come to me, because I make plans to be pure in all my ways. 

By living a righteous life, I help to exalt the nation. I am a wise and faithful citizen, and receive promotion from those in positions of power. 

I work hard at what I do, and great abundance comes to me. I do not merely talk about getting rich while living to only pursue my pleasure. That would bring me face-to-face with poverty. My true net worth is the wealth that wisdom imparts. 

I speak the truth, and I save souls. Confidence and strength flood my heart. I love you, Father, and live in reverent awe of you. My devotion provides my children with a place of shelter and security.

I find a strong hope, even in the time of death. Worshiping you in wonder and awe opens a fountain of life within me and empowers me to escape death's domain. Wisdom soothes my heart with living-understanding.  

My heart overflows with understanding, and I'm very slow to get angry. 

I have a tender, tranquil heart, and it makes me healthy. I liberate the powerless. I show kindness to the poor, and in so doing, I bring you honor, Father. 

So be it.
